1.Except as otherwise provided in subsection 4, all reasonable expenses incurred by the Board in carrying out the provisions of this chapter must be paid from the money which it receives. No part of the salaries or expenses of the Board may be paid out of the State General Fund.
2.Except as otherwise provided in this section, all money collected by the Board from the imposition of fines must be deposited with the State Treasurer for credit to the State General Fund. All other money received by the Board must be deposited in qualified banks, credit unions, savings and loan associations or savings banks in this State and paid out on its order for its expenses.
